Transaction cd91ba2a917cf643e0083a91fd22184cdc3fde934a61fa066e22b1ea5c73ec9c

1 Input
2 Outputs
  • cd91ba2a917cf643e0083a91fd22184cdc3fde934a61fa066e22b1ea5c73ec9c:0
  • value  20000000
    address  1inffiSYmFnqrCPeKVW5X7VVyrkFRAgGw
  • cd91ba2a917cf643e0083a91fd22184cdc3fde934a61fa066e22b1ea5c73ec9c:1
  • value  20989160
    address  192tspsPTob2EhLbXNaEqHNp49QRJGJ4Yb